| Description | This full length portrait is of a man and woman dressed in outdoor finery. He is standing on the left of the image, wearing a long dark overcoat with white shirt and top hat. He is carrying a closed umbrella. The woman is standing on the right. She is wearing a long light-colored overcoat with details on the lapels and cuffs. The coat is open, showing a dark skirt and light, high-necked blouse. She is wearing a hat with a large feather. |

| Notes | The original negative envelope is labeled "Dr. Benadom". The image is very similar to X328 and X329 and appears to have been taken at the same time. William A. Benadom first appears in the Davenport city directory in 1902-1903. In 1905 he married his third wife, Sadie. It is probable that this photograph is of William and Sadie Benadom. |
